閱讀英文

共用方式為


Word) (Columns 物件

一組 資料行 代表表格中的欄的物件。

註解

使用 範圍選取範圍表格 物件的 資料行 屬性可傳回 Columns 集合。 下列範例會顯示使用中文件的第一個表格的 Columns 集合中的 Column 物件數目。

MsgBox ActiveDocument.Tables(1).Columns.Count

下列範例會建立一個含有六欄和三列的表格,然後使用逐漸增加的 (較濃) 網底百分比來格式化每個欄。

Set myTable = ActiveDocument.Tables.Add(Range:=Selection.Range, _ 
 NumRows:=3, NumColumns:=6) 
For Each col In myTable.Columns 
 col.Shading.Texture = 2 + i 
 i = i + 1 
Next col

使用 [ 新增 若要將欄新增至表格的方法。 下列範例會將欄新增至使用中文件的第一個表格,然後它讓欄寬一致。

If ActiveDocument.Tables.Count >= 1 Then 
 Set myTable = ActiveDocument.Tables(1) 
 myTable.Columns.Add BeforeColumn:=myTable.Columns(1) 
 myTable.Columns.DistributeWidth 
End If

使用 資料行 (Index),其中 Index 是索引編號,可以傳回單一 Column 物件。 索引編號代表資料行 (從左到右統計) Columns 集合中的位置。 下列範例會選取第一個表格的第一欄。

ActiveDocument.Tables(1).Columns(1).Select

方法

屬性

請參閱

Word 物件模型參考資料

支援和意見反應

有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應